Names in Other Languages

Japanese ウスグロアリドリ
Chinese 暗蚁鸟
Spanish Hormiguero tirano
French Grisin sombre
German Dunkelgrauer Ameisenfänger
Portuguese chororó-escuro
Russian Тиранновая кустарниковая муравьянка

What family does Dunkelgrauer Ameisenfänger belong to?
Dunkelgrauer Ameisenfänger (Cercomacra tyrannina) belongs to the genus Cercomacra, which is part of the taxonomic family Thamnophilidae.
